What you are describing sounds correct. The IRS presumes that the income reported on an IRS form 1099-NEC is subject to self-employment tax as well as income tax.
The software wants you to establish a self-employment activity in Schedule C. Then deposit the IRS form 1099-NEC income into the self-employment activity.
